How it works
Moundsville Penitentiary, operational from 1876 to 1995, was once home to over 19,000 inmates, many of whom lived and died within its walls. Today, visitors can take a guided tour of the facility, which includes areas where some of the most notorious inmates were held. Participants will explore the cells, corridors, and solitary confinement areas, all while learning about the history of the prison and its infamous residents. Some tours offer additional activities, such as ghost-hunting equipment and paranormal investigations, for a more immersive experience. Each tour is designed to provide a comprehensive and eerie exploration of the penitentiary's dark past.
Q: Is the penitentiary truly haunted?
While the paranormal activity within the prison's walls is a topic of debate, many visitors have reported strange occurrences, from unexplained noises to ghostly apparitions. There is no scientific evidence to support the existence of ghosts, but the unexplained events have left a lasting impression on many. Some believe that the high number of deaths within the prison has led to an intense emotional energy, causing the spirits of former inmates to linger. Others propose that the prison's dark history has created a unique atmospheric environment, ripe for paranormal activity.

Those interested in visiting the Moundsville Penitentiary should be aware of the potential risks involved. While the guided tours are generally considered safe, visitors may experience unlocked doors, sudden drops in temperature, or unexplained noises. Additionally, the prison's infrastructure is largely original, which can lead to uneven flooring and potential hazards. It's essential to follow the rules and stay with the tour group to minimize any potential risks.
Common misconceptions
Some visitors assume that the Moundsville Penitentiary is nothing more than a haunted house, but it's essential to remember that this location is an important piece of American history. The prison served as a hub for reforms, with some inmates participating in rehabilitation programs and becoming productive members of society upon release. Additionally, the location is not merely a destination for thrill-seekers, but also an educational experience that teaches visitors about the consequences of crime and the need for social reform.
